Learning Opportunities
Areas of specialties include but are not limited to mens and womens health, endocrinology with a special focus on diabetes mellitus and weight loss, cardiology with special focus in congestive heart failure, pediatrics, infectious diseases, transplant and special populations including geriatric population with additional training in medication therapy management.
Required Experiences:
- Orientation (one month in duration)
Longitudinal (approximately 10 months in duration)
- Family Medicine/Primary Care
- Infectious Disease
- Geriatrics
- Endocrinology
- Research
- Cardiology
- Administrative
- Precepting
Elective Experiences (one month in duration)
- Pediatric Hematology/Oncology
- Outpatient Infusion
- Solid Organ Transplant

Benefits
Full dental, health and vision coverage available
12 days of paid time off
Personal Laptop
Paid attendance for one national and one regional conference
